TheObservatory is a room located upstairs in themuseum. It is run byCeleste, the sister of Blathers. It was first introduced inAnimal Crossing: Wild World and also featured inAnimal Crossing: City Folk.
In the observatory, there is a large telescope that players can look through. Players can do three things with the telescope: they can stargaze at the sky, create constellations, or delete constellations.
If players wish to create a constellation, they are given a view of the starry sky and can create a constellation with up to 16 lines. When the process is finished,Celeste will then ask them what they would like to call the constellation. Once the constellation is named, she will put the design in the database and will mention to the player the day and time the constellation will be in the optimum viewing point in the sky.
When a player visits a friend locally or over Wi-Fi, or usesTag Mode to make contact with another town, the players will exchange constellations, meaning that each player will see their friend's constellations in the sky in addition to their own. Some of each players' own creations may be removed to make room for the friend's, however.
